Visiting Venezuela for the first time? Here's what you need to know
Know the entry rules before you fly. Rules can change depending on your reason for travel and your passport. Always check with official sources like your travel agent, airline or the local embassy.
Venezuela is home to around 29 million people.
Pick the season that matches how you like to travel, whether that's hotter, cooler or somewhere in between. March is one of the warmest months in Venezuela.
Conditions are often coolest around July.
You can expect more rain in August, while January is generally drier.
Thinking about timing your Chicago to Venezuela flight with something big? Headline events worth planning around include Carnival celebrations, the Caracas International Film Festival and the Dancing Devils of Yare religious festival.
